Audi DTC P1132 – O2 Sensor Heating Circuit, Bank1+2-Sensor1 Short to B+
DTC P1132 meaning on Audi
DTC P1132 on an Audi indicates a fault with the O2 sensor heating circuit for Bank 1 and Bank 2, Sensor 1. This fault specifically points to a short circuit to battery positive (B+).
Audi DTC P1132 symptoms
Symptoms of DTC P1132 on an Audi may include poor fuel economy, rough idling, engine misfires, and potentially an illuminated Check Engine Light on the dashboard.
Audi DTC P1132 causes
The causes of DTC P1132 on an Audi can be attributed to a short circuit in the O2 sensor heating circuit for Bank 1 and Bank 2, Sensor 1. This could be due to damaged wiring, a faulty O2 sensor, or a malfunctioning engine control module (ECM).
Audi DTC P1132 seriousness
While DTC P1132 may not cause immediate drivability issues, it can lead to poor engine performance and increased emissions. Ignoring this fault can potentially cause long-term damage to the vehicle’s engine and emissions system.
How to diagnose DTC P1132 on Audi
To diagnose DTC P1132 on an Audi, a mechanic would typically use a diagnostic scanner to retrieve the fault code and then perform a visual inspection of the O2 sensor wiring and connections. Testing the O2 sensor and checking the ECM for proper operation may also be necessary.
How to fix DTC P1132 on Audi
Fixing DTC P1132 on an Audi involves identifying and repairing the short circuit in the O2 sensor heating circuit. This may require repairing or replacing damaged wiring, replacing the faulty O2 sensor, or addressing any issues with the ECM. Once the fault is rectified, clearing the fault code and resetting the Check Engine Light is recommended.
How to erase DTC P1132 on Audi
To erase DTC P1132 on an Audi, a diagnostic scanner can be used to clear the fault code from the ECM’s memory. After the repair has been completed and the fault code erased, it is advisable to test drive the vehicle to ensure the issue has been resolved and the fault code does not reappear.
